The  Difference between Tantra and Dual Cultivation

Tantric and Dual Cultivation methods and techniques have many similarities once you remove their religious and cultural wrappings. There is one majordifference, however. Tantra is primarily a method for raising Sexual Qi up the spine to create a state of ecstasy. For many people this can be a religious or spiritual experience as well as an incredibly powerful way of working with Sexual Qi. Dual Cultivation also works with moving Sexual Qi up the spine; the fundamental difference between the Tantric and the Taoist methods is that the Taoist techniques move the Sexual Qi back down the front of the body to complete the ‘Xiao Zhou Tian’. This circular movement of energy has been translated as ‘Microcosmic Orbit’, ‘Small Heavenly Circulation’ or ‘Small Orbit’. This circulation of Qi has a profound healing and energizing effect as the generated energy is packed or stored back into the body. Tantra therefore focuses on the ecstatic release of sexual energy and is quasireligious, sometimes at the expense of the physical body. Dual Cultivation, onthe other hand, is a method of using sexual energy to promote good health and longevity as well as spiritual development. This is an important point that is very often not made clear, especially when reading Tantric source material and laterNeo-Tantric books and other instructional material.
